Understanding Camo Patterns

Choosing the right camouflage pattern is the foundational step in selecting your hat. It's not merely about color; it's about understanding the visual disruption each pattern creates. Camouflage works by breaking up the human silhouette using contrasting shapes, colors, and tones that mimic the surrounding environment. Let's explore some of the most prevalent patterns. Woodland, characterized by its large, blotchy patches of green, brown, and black, is a classic designed for temperate forested areas. Its successor, the Digital or pixelated pattern (like MARPAT or CADPAT), uses small, square pixels to create a more effective, computer-generated blur at a distance, excelling in both woodland and urban settings. Multicam, a modern favorite, employs a combination of organic shapes and a wider color palette (tans, greens, browns) to provide adaptability across multiple environments, from desert fringes to wooded terrain. For arid regions, patterns like Desert Tiger Stripe or Three-Color Desert use broad swathes of tan and brown. When selecting a pattern, consider two primary factors: your intended environment and personal preference. If you're a hunter, matching the local foliage is paramount. For casual or fashion use, the choice becomes more aesthetic—do you prefer the retro vibe of classic Woodland or the tech-forward look of Digital? In Hong Kong's diverse outdoor scenes, from the trails of Tai Mo Shan to the urban jungle of Mong Kok, patterns like Multicam or simpler olive drab can offer versatile appeal. Remember, the pattern sets the stage for your patch, so choose one that complements rather than clashes with your intended design.

Exploring Patch Options

The patch is the soul of your customized camo hat. The variety available is staggering, starting with the construction method. Embroidered patches are the most common, created by stitching colored threads onto a fabric backing. They offer a classic, textured, and durable finish, ideal for detailed logos and text. PVC patches are made from molded rubber-like material, offering a modern, 3D look with vibrant colors that are highly resistant to weathering and fading. Woven patches are similar to embroidered but use finer threads for a smoother, more detailed appearance, often used for complex designs. Beyond construction, themes are limitless. Military and tactical patches (flags, unit crests, morale patches) are perennial favorites. Humorous or ironic patches add personality, while patches reflecting personal interests—bands, sports teams, hobbies like fishing or gaming—make the hat uniquely yours. The frontier of customization lies in creating your own patch. Many online services allow you to upload artwork, choose materials and borders, and produce small batches. For truly unique, full-color photographic designs, are a cutting-edge option. This process uses heat to transfer dye directly into the patch fabric, allowing for photorealistic images, gradients, and intricate artwork without the texture of stitching. This technology is perfect for creating a one-of-a-kind patch featuring a personal photo, a complex logo, or an artistic graphic that would be impossible with traditional embroidery.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Camo Hat

Beyond pattern and patch, the hat itself must be carefully evaluated across several dimensions to ensure comfort, functionality, and longevity. First, consider the style. The baseball cap is the universal choice, offering a curved brim and a structured front. The trucker hat features a mesh back for breathability, making it excellent for hot weather. The boonie hat, with its wide, floppy brim all around, provides superior sun and rain protection for serious outdoor use. Snapbacks and adjustable strapbacks offer universal fit, while fitted caps provide a sleeker look. Material is crucial for performance. Cotton is soft and breathable but less water-resistant. Polyester and nylon are durable, quick-drying, and often treated for water resistance. Ripstop fabric, woven with reinforced threads in a crosshatch pattern, is exceptionally durable and resistant to tearing, a top choice for hard-use scenarios. Fit and adjustability are non-negotiable for comfort. An ill-fitting hat is a distraction. Look for features like a leather or fabric strap with a buckle, a plastic snap closure, or a hook-and-loop fastener for micro-adjustments. The sweatband should be absorbent and comfortable. Finally, assess quality and durability. Examine the stitching—it should be tight, even, and without loose threads. Check the brim; it should be firm but not rigidly uncomfortable. The patch attachment should be secure, whether sewn, heat-pressed, or attached with hook-and-loop (like Velcro® . A high-quality camo hat, especially one intended to showcase a prized patch, is an investment worth making.

Caring for Your Camo Hat

Proper care extends the life of your camo hat and keeps its patch looking vibrant. Washing requires a gentle touch. Always check the manufacturer's label first. For most cotton or polyester hats, hand washing in cool water with a mild detergent is safest. Use a soft brush to gently scrub soiled areas, particularly the sweatband. Rinse thoroughly. Never put a structured hat in the washing machine or dryer, as this can destroy its shape, fade colors, and damage the patch. For drying, reshape the hat while damp and let it air dry naturally away from direct heat or sunlight, which can cause shrinkage and color bleaching. Storage is equally important. Do not crush your hat in a crowded drawer or bag. Instead, store it on a hat rack, in a hat box, or simply on a shelf. For travel, consider a collapsible hat form or a dedicated hat carrier. Preserving the patch demands specific attention. For embroidered or woven patches, avoid excessive abrasion. For PVC patches, clean with a damp cloth; avoid harsh chemicals. For sublimated patches, which are particularly sensitive to high heat, avoid leaving the hat in hot cars or under intense sunlight for prolonged periods, as this can cause the vibrant hat patch sublimation designs to fade over time. If the patch is attached via hook-and-loop, you can often remove it before washing the hat for extra safety. A little mindful maintenance ensures your personalized statement piece remains in prime condition for years.
